Delta NUJ Congratulates Engr. Matthew Tonlagha, As He Clocks 50
By Daniel Dafe
The Nigeria Union of Journalists (NUJ), Delta State Council, has congratulated Engr. Matthew Tonlagha, as he marks his Golden Jubilee, describing the celebrant “as a distinguished development advocate and patriotic Nigerian,
This was contained in a statement on Monday signed by Comrade Churchill Oyowe
Chairman and Comrade Josephine Omodior, Acting Secretary.
The statement continued: “Today, we celebrate not just the attainment of 50 fruitful years, but the life of a man whose actions consistently reflect the core values of the NUJ, service to humanity, commitment to truth, national development, and the promotion of societal good.
“At 50, Engr. Tonlagha stands tall as an exemplary leader of vision, integrity, and uncommon humility.
“His life and career have been defined by resilience, professionalism, and a commitment to uplifting people and institutions. These virtues resonate strongly with the NUJ creed, which places premium value on responsibility, public interest, and ethical leadership.”
Furthermore, Delta NUJ, said: “As a development-driven professional, Engr. Matthew Tonlagha has continued to deploy his influence and resources in advancing meaningful causes that strengthen institutions and empower communities. Of particular note is his instrumental role in facilitating the construction of a fully equipped NUJ Secretariat Building in Warri through Tantita Security Services Limited. This landmark intervention has significantly enhanced the operational capacity, welfare, and professional environment of journalists in Delta State, especially those within the Warri axis.
“This singular contribution stands as a testament to his belief in a strong media as a cornerstone of democracy, accountability, and good governance. It also underscores his deep appreciation of the press as a partner in nation-building.”
